A way to uninstall PicPick from your system

You can find below detailed information on how to remove PicPick for Windows. The Windows release was developed by NGWIN. You can find out more on NGWIN or check for application updates here. More information about PicPick can be found at . The program is often installed in the C:\Program Files (x86)\PicPick folder. Take into account that this path can vary being determined by the user's preference. You can remove PicPick by clicking on the Start menu of Windows and pasting the command line C:\Program Files (x86)\PicPick\uninst.exe. Keep in mind that you might get a notification for administrator rights. The application's main executable file is called picpick.exe and its approximative size is 43.86 MB (45993504 bytes).

The following executables are incorporated in PicPick. They take 79.62 MB (83489157 bytes) on disk.

  • picpick.exe (43.86 MB)
  • picpick_plugin.exe (13.07 MB)
  • picpick_uploader.exe (22.60 MB)
  • uninst.exe (86.20 KB)
